Women's Hockey
It did not take long for Boston University to make a name for itself in the world of women’s ice hockey.

Entering just its fifth season as a varsity program, the Terriers look to continue the impressive strides made over their first four years. During the 2008-09 season, the Terriers reached the Hockey East playoffs for the second consecutive year -- including the program's first postseason win, at Walter Brown Arena -- and were nationally ranked for the first time.

Head coach Brian Durocher, who was Jack Parker’s top assistant before taking over the women’s program upon its inception, has led the program since its inception. A goalie and captain of the 1978 men’s ice hockey national championship team, Durocher was instrumental in helping BU host the 2009 NCAA Women's Frozen Four at Agganis Arena.

Walter Brown Arena
Walter Brown Arena at Case Center is the home of Terrier women's ice hockey. Walter Brown Arena is located at 285 Babcock Street.
